Edging is the practice of producing clean, specified borders in between various landscape components, such as yards, garden beds, paths, and outdoor patios. Proper edging enhances the visual appeal of a home, avoids yard from intruding into flower beds, and makes maintenance jobs like mowing easier and more accurate. Methods include installing physical barriers like metal, plastic, or stone edging, as well as forming soil or grass to create natural boundaries. Material choice and installation methods differ depending on the desired visual, landscape design, and long-term durability. Regular upkeep of edges prevents overgrowth, keeps crisp lines, and contributes to a refined, intentional look. Effective edging is both a practical tool and a style aspect, enhancing the general company and charm of a landscape
